WitrynaShearing, also known as die cutting, is a process that cuts stock without the formation of chips or the use of burning or melting. In strict technical terms, the process of “shearing” involves the use of straight cutting bladesorm of sheet metal or plates, however, rods can also be sheared. Once he’d fleeced a cocky’s paddocks, he’d set off to shear some more, Shaun … WitrynaSome differences you need to take note of when using these words are: they are spelled the same way except for an "A" in "shear" as opposed to the "E" in "sheer." As a verb, "shear" means to cut, trim, or clip, while "sheer" means to swerve suddenly from a course. As a noun, "shear" is a cutting tool like scissors but more extensive, while ... boldness images
